As of this year I now have adopted three sections of highway I clean. The new 4 miles is on Rt. 7 - the main road into Williamstown. It is not the amount of garbage, the cars/trucks speeding past, or the people that throw their garbage out the window right in front of me (if I get their plate # I turn them in) that scares/bothers me...it is the number of beer cans and liquor bottles I pick up that scares me. With all the attention being paid to drinking and driving and the stiff penalties levied here in MA even for your first DWI, you would think people would would have more sense. Today alone, after one week, I picked up 49 beer cans (mostly Bud Light and Coors Silver Bullet - both disgusting as far as I am concerned) and 13 pint bottles of liquor all Popov Vodka... why is this so popular?

So it seems that people are not only drinking and driving, but drinking WHILE driving. That is scary as hell...at least to me.
